What companies run services between Newton Centre (Station), MA, USA and North Station (subway), MA, USA?

MBTA operates a vehicle from Newton Centre to North Station every 15 minutes. Tickets cost $3 and the journey takes 43 min.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Centre St @ Beacon St to North Station (subway) via Galen St @ Water St, Technology Way @ Watertown Yard, and Federal St @ Franklin St in around 1h 22m.
